Six Rohingyas, including children, sustained burn injuries from a gas cylinder fire at Ukhiya camp in Cox's Bazar Thursday, police said.
The injured were identified as Nur Alam, his wife, their two sons and two others from a nearby home.
They are being treated at Kutupalong MSF Hospital, said Naimul Haque, commander of Cox's Bazar Armed Police Battalion-14.
The fire broke out at the house of Nur Alam at Block D/4 of Ukhiya Rohingya Camp 1/East.
"Alam's wife was trying to light their gas stove in the morning but it did not work. She might have left the gas cylinder on to light the stove with a matchstick, which caused the fire," said Naimul.
